Best way ive found is to download the Cisco Icon pack for
visio. Drag an icon onto a blank visio diagram and save the diagram as an .emf
(enhanced metafile) in your WUG directory. You can then use these on your maps
as clip art by pointing the clipart object in your maps to the appropriate emf
file.
If you want to create monitored objects from the icons just
click on configure/device types on the menu bar and create a new device type
that points to the emf file. Looks a whole lot better than the built in
icons:-)
The only problem with this is that WUG stretches the icons
to fit the square, you can limit this from becoming disproportionate by adding
some text just above the icon. I add the device type such as "2600" or "3500"
just above the icon before I save it to prevent this. Its pretty much trial and
error but its not difficult.
search the knowledge base for "visio icons" on the WUG
website for the full details
